First Nations communities along Highway 8 reconnected as route reopens to public
KAMLOOPS — “The good news as of today is people will be able to drive from here in Merritt to Spences Bridge all along Highway 8 for the first time in nearly one year,” said B.C. Transportation Minister Rob Fleming.
On November 15, 2021 a one-in-250-year weather event hit the province of B.C., causing devastating flooding in the Nicola Valley. More than eight kilometres of Highway 8 was washed out.
Along with Highway 8, the Coquihalla, Highway 3 and Highway 1 were also damaged leading to approximately $250 million in repairs.
